Loading...
Loading...
Sync cookies from local Chrome to a Browserbase persistent context so the browse CLI can access authenticated sites. Use when the user wants to browse as themselves, sync cookies, or log into sites via Browserbase.
npx skill4agent add browserbase/skills cookie-syncbrowsechrome://flags/#allow-remote-debugging--remote-debugging-port=9222 --user-data-dir=/tmp/chrome-debugCDP_URL=ws://127.0.0.1:9222BROWSERBASE_API_KEYcd .claude/skills/cookie-sync && npm installnode .claude/skills/cookie-sync/scripts/cookie-sync.mjsnode .claude/skills/cookie-sync/scripts/cookie-sync.mjs --domains google.com,github.comgoogle.comaccounts.google.commail.google.comnode .claude/skills/cookie-sync/scripts/cookie-sync.mjs --context ctx_abc123node .claude/skills/cookie-sync/scripts/cookie-sync.mjs --stealthnode .claude/skills/cookie-sync/scripts/cookie-sync.mjs --proxy "San Francisco,CA,US""City,ST,Country"node .claude/skills/cookie-sync/scripts/cookie-sync.mjs --domains github.com,google.com --stealth --proxy "San Francisco,CA,US"browsebrowse open https://mail.google.com --context-id <ctx-id> --persist--persist# Step 1: Sync cookies for Twitter
node .claude/skills/cookie-sync/scripts/cookie-sync.mjs --domains x.com,twitter.com
# Output: Context ID: ctx_abc123
# Step 2: Browse authenticated Twitter
browse open https://x.com/messages --context-id ctx_abc123 --persist
browse snapshot
browse screenshot
browse stopbrowse open <url> --context-id <ctx-id> --persist--context <ctx-id>chrome://flags/#allow-remote-debugging--remote-debugging-port=9222CDP_URL=ws://127.0.0.1:9222--context <id>--stealth--proxy